As a Commissioning BMS Manager, you will play a crucial role in the successful delivery of complex building services systems across high-profile projects. You will be responsible for the planning, coordination, execution, and documentation of all commissioning activities related to Building Management Systems (BMS), ensuring quality, compliance, and client satisfaction.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ead and manage the end-to-end BMS commissioning process across multiple large-scale projects.
- Develop and implement commissioning strategies, schedules, scopes, and resource plans aligned with project requirements.
- Ensure all BMS systems are commissioned according to contractual and regulatory standards.
- Coordinate commissioning activities with clients, general contractors, and system vendors.
- Monitor and report on commissioning progress, identifying risks and implementing corrective actions.
- Produce comprehensive technical reports, test documentation, and validation records.
- Provide expert input on design reviews, technical submittals, method statements, and functional test procedures.
- Support tender development and provide input into proposal documentation.
- Ensure strict compliance with health & safety, environmental, and quality standards.
- Actively contribute to continuous improvement of internal systems and processes.
